Hey Thanks Yogi I did see that there’s many parts available which is reassuring I guess what I’m asking is I’m considering buying a 125 but are they ok as a daily use bike or would I be buying an unreliable money pit by today’s standards ? And of course they are strong money Thanks for your input 👍
|
|
|
Post by Chewie01 on Nov 19, 2020 18:28:59 GMT 1
If the bikes been put together well, then there shouldn't be any specific reason why it couldn't be used daily. If that's your intention then get one that hasn't been messed with by the porting fairies.
Personally I wouldn't want to use a classic bike as a daily driver, mainly to prevent it from rotting away from salty roads.
